Music & Entertainment | Venue finder 22 Laugavegur 22 | G7 A popular place among the city´s party scenesters, this three storied bar makes for a great night out with chatting upstairs and dancing downstairs with regular DJs. Amsterdam Hafnarstræti 5 | E6 Kaffi Amsterdam seems to have been around forever, though recently it’s been rein- vented as a live venue. Good music, cheap beer, and colorful characters to be found. Apótek Austurstræti 16 | E5 Sporting a chic and pristine interior with a blend of modern minimalism and ornate baroque, a decent spot with eager service and an international menu. B5 Bankastræti 5 | F6 By day a chic little bistro with good food and a prime location for Laugavegur people watching | by night a stylish bar with a “whiskey room” and manhattanesque clientele. Bar 11 Laugavegur 11 | G6 A happening Rock hangout right on Laugavegur, brings in the Iceland rock scene whether on the jukebox or in person mainly on Tuesdays but throughout the week. Belly´s Hafnarstræti 18a | E5 Belly´s deserves praise for having the cheap- est bar prices around. Good for anyone look- ing for a deal, there are enough tables for everyone and TVs for sport | watching. Boston Laugavegur 28b | H6 A fresh addition to the Reykjavík bar scene. Roomy bar floor, nice sofas and stylish interior make this a comfy café as well as a tavern with good, unintrusive music. Café Cultura Hverfisgata 18 | G6 Situated in the inter- cultural centre, Cultura is a café/bar with a cosmopolitan feel. The menu features all sorts of international dishes, alongside the staple salad and sandwich. Café Paris Austurstræti 14 | E5 With an outdoor ter- race, this café gets busy on sunny days. With a cosy interior, fine menu and atten- tive service, it makes a fine spot for evening dining as well. Café Victor Hafnarstræti 1-3| D4 A hangout for older foreigners, Victor at- tracts a diverse crowd, both in age and origin, a rule that extends to the musicians that play there. Celtic Cross Hverfisgata 26 | H6 Arguably the most authentic Irish pub in town, a very lively space with live music every night, sometimes two bands playing at once. Dillon Laugavegur 30 | H7 The quintessential rock pub Dillion serves moderately priced drinks, and has pretty good music, too. The mix of students and tattooed tough guys always creates a fun atmosphere. Domo Þingholtstræti 5 | F6 The elegantly deco- rated Domo serves delicious French-Asian cuisine, excellent sushi and has a great wine list. A sure choice. Dubliner Hafnarstræti 4 | E5 The city’s main Irish pub attracts quite a lot of foreigners, though there´s an influx of locals on weekends. Good if you’re looking for the darker stuff on tap. Glaumbar Tryggvagata 20 | E4 The premier sports bar in town, though after the final whistle, DJs take the floor and be- gin a night of feverish dancing. Grand Rokk Smiðjustígur | G6 As its Viking theme ac- curately displays, this hardcore chess hang- out is no place for the lily | livered. Take the pub quiz on Fridays at 17.30, the winner gets a free case of beer! Hressó Austurstræti 20 | E5 With a spacious neutral interior, pleas- ant courtyard and a varied lunch menu, Hressó attracts no specific type of crowd. Tap beer and music makes a fair hangout on weekends. Hverfisbarinn Hverfisgata 20 | G6 After a long line, you’ll get in and wonder what all the fuss was about. You may end up here if you’re still going at 4 on a Sunday morning, in which case it’s just as good as any. Kaffi Hljómalind Laugavegur 21 | G6 This organic, free-trade café prides itself not only on great food and coffee but being a strong cultural center, hosting live music as well as lectures and poetry nights. Kaffibarinn Bergstraðastræti 1 | F6 A popular place to grab a drink after work, this daytime coffee joint roils with night- time activity on week- ends with live DJs. Parties often pound until dawn. NASA Þorvaldsenstræti 2 | The cornerstone of Reykjavík nightlife, NASA has multiple bars and hosts some of Reykjavík’s best bands. Shows go on all night long on weekends. Næsti Bar Ingólfstræti 1A | F6 On nights where queues snake down Laugavegur, Naesti Bar can be great place to sneak off to and chat with friends over a beer. Frequented also by the literary and acting elite. Óliver Laugavegur 20A | H7 This stylish nightclub attracts a glamorous crowd of crazy dancers that may not be for ev- eryone. In which case, air | conditioning and fine food make Oliver a good lunch spot. Ölstofan Vegamótastígur | G6 No tricks here. You’ll want just simple beer in this simple pub. Also the hangout for Reykjavík intellectual circles. Organ Hafnarstræti 1-3 | E4 This trendy bar and concert venue pres- ents a wide range of international and local musicians from all lev- els of renown. Shows 4 times a week, lasting late on weekends. Prikið Bankastræti | F5 Part of the Reykjavík bar scene for decades, this café/bar has a fairly cheap menu and attracts a mix of stu- dents and old regulars. R&B and Hip-Hop plays on weekends. Q-Bar Ingólfstræti 3 | F6 A roomy gay/straight bar and a welcome addition to downtown nightlife. Some of the best DJs in town play regularly, making it an especially lively space on weekends. Rex Austurstræti | E5 Rex is quite fancy and you may feel out of place if you don’t dress up a bit. Definitely one of the more posh spots in town. Sólon Bankastræti 7A | F5 Truly a jack | of | all trades establishment. By night a decent res- taurant, by day a café/ bistro and on Friday and Saturday nights a nightclub. Art exhibi- tions on the walls to top it off. Thorvaldsen Austurstræti 8 | E5 Dress formally for this fancy spot, and come before 12 to avoid a long line. DJs play Thursdays, Fridays and Saturdays. Vegamót Vegamótastígur 4 | G6 Vegamót´s kitchen is open until 22.00 daily and sports an appeal- ing lunch menu. Come for a tasty brunch on weekends. If you like Óliver, try Vegamót and vice versa.
